mirror of
https://github.com/postgres/postgres.git
synced 2025-07-12 21:01:52 +03:00
Backend support for autocommit removed, per recent discussions. The
only remnant of this failed experiment is that the server will take SET AUTOCOMMIT TO ON. Still TODO: provide some client-side autocommit logic in libpq.
This commit is contained in:
@ -5,7 +5,7 @@
|
||||
* Portions Copyright (c) 1996-2003, PostgreSQL Global Development Group
|
||||
* Portions Copyright (c) 1994, Regents of the University of California
|
||||
*
|
||||
* $Header: /cvsroot/pgsql/src/bin/scripts/createdb.c,v 1.1 2003/03/18 22:19:46 petere Exp $
|
||||
* $Header: /cvsroot/pgsql/src/bin/scripts/createdb.c,v 1.2 2003/05/14 03:26:03 tgl Exp $
|
||||
*
|
||||
*-------------------------------------------------------------------------
|
||||
*/
|
||||
@ -143,7 +143,7 @@ main(int argc, char *argv[])
|
||||
|
||||
initPQExpBuffer(&sql);
|
||||
|
||||
appendPQExpBuffer(&sql, "SET autocommit TO on;\nCREATE DATABASE %s",
|
||||
appendPQExpBuffer(&sql, "CREATE DATABASE %s",
|
||||
fmtId(dbname));
|
||||
|
||||
if (owner)
|
||||
@ -181,7 +181,7 @@ main(int argc, char *argv[])
|
||||
|
||||
if (comment)
|
||||
{
|
||||
printfPQExpBuffer(&sql, "SET autocommit TO on;\nCOMMENT ON DATABASE %s IS ", fmtId(dbname));
|
||||
printfPQExpBuffer(&sql, "COMMENT ON DATABASE %s IS ", fmtId(dbname));
|
||||
appendStringLiteral(&sql, comment, false);
|
||||
appendPQExpBuffer(&sql, ";\n");
|
||||
|
||||
|
Reference in New Issue
Block a user